About agriculture in Thornton Heath

Thornton Heath is situated in the southern part of Greater London, bordering the county of Surrey in South East England. While the immediate area is predominantly urban, it serves as a gateway to the rolling hills and fertile plains of the North Downs. The surrounding countryside is characterized by a mix of wooded areas, open pastures, and traditional English hedgerows that define the rural landscape of the home counties.

The agricultural sector in the nearby Surrey countryside focuses on a blend of livestock and specialized horticulture. Cattle and sheep grazing are common on the slopes of the Downs, while the low-lying areas support market gardens and nurseries that supply fresh produce to the London metropolitan area. There is also a significant presence of arable farming, with wheat and barley being the primary crops grown in the larger fields.

For agricultural specialists and seasonal workers, the region offers diverse opportunities ranging from greenhouse management to estate maintenance. The proximity to London means there is a consistent demand for skilled agronomists to oversee high-intensity horticultural projects. Farm workers can often find seasonal employment during the harvest periods or within the year-round operations of local plant nurseries and equestrian centers.
